MySQL自动安装,解放双手(mysql不用手动安装)

在进行软件开发和网站搭建过程中,数据库系统是一个必不可少的组成部分。MySQL作为一个领先的关系型数据库管理系统,被广泛应用于各种应用场景。然而,对于尚未掌握MySQL安装技能的开发者来说,MySQL的安装过程可能会让他们感到困惑和繁琐。如果每次都要手动安装MySQL,那么时间和精力将是一个可观的价值损失。因此,本文介绍如何使用脚本实现MySQL的自动安装,让双手得到解放。

一、安装所需依赖

在开始MySQL的自动安装前,我们需要先安装一些必要的依赖库。

$ sudo apt-get update
$ sudo apt-get install git-core make gcc cmake

二、下载MySQL源代码

我们可以从MySQL官网下载源代码。

$ wget -c https://cdn.mysql.com//Downloads/MySQL-5.7/mysql-5.7.23.tar.gz
$ tar zxvf mysql-5.7.23.tar.gz
$ cd mysql-5.7.23

三、配置源代码

执行以下命令,进入MySQL源代码的配置页面。

$ cmake .

如果我们希望在MySQL的安装过程中启用一些额外的功能,可以使用一些选项来配置源代码。例如,我们可以使用“-DWITH_SSL=system”选项启用SSL支持,使用“-DWITH_DEBUG=1”选项启用调试功能。

四、编译和安装

执行以下命令,开始编译和安装MySQL。

$ make
$ sudo make install

如果因为权限问题导致编译和安装失败,可以尝试在编译前使用以下命令切换到超级用户模式。

$ sudo -s

五、设置MySQL环境变量

使用以下命令,在~/.bashrc文件中添加mysql的PATH。

$ echo 'export PATH=$PATH:/usr/local/mysql/bin' >> ~/.bashrc
$ source ~/.bashrc

六、启动MySQL服务

MySQL安装成功后,需要启动MySQL服务器运行。

$ cd /usr/local/mysql
$ bin/mysqld_safe &

七、MySQL配置

通过以下命令,可以登录MySQL。

$ mysql -u root

在MySQL中,我们可以进行用户管理,权限控制等诸多操作。具体操作方式可以参考MySQL官方文档。

八、总结

本文介绍了如何使用脚本实现MySQL的自动安装。通过使用脚本,我们可以实现自动化、高效的MySQL部署,节省时间和精力。如果您是一位刚刚接触MySQL的开发者,希望您可以尝试使用以上方法,解放双手,更好地专注于开发工作。


数据运维技术 » MySQL自动安装,解放双手(mysql不用手动安装)